The basics 'done well' results in nice chapter site for members to visit
Grant County WI Chapter earns Web Site of the Month honors
Congratulations to the leaders of the Grant County WI Chapter, especially to Janelle Davis, chapter Internet Advisor and Web site administrator, whose site has been named Chapter Web Site of the Month for November.
The site may not include many "splashy" features, but it covers the basics in a clean, easy-to-read and easy-to-navigate format.
"My goal was to develop an easy-to-navigate and cohesive Web siteone where the content is informative and visually pleasing without being overwhelming," says Janelle. "One key to a successful chapter is good communications between members, congregational coordinators and chapter board members. It is my hope that this Web site will help facilitate communication and awareness within our chapter."
Janelle is meeting her goals as she has developed a very nice site that is user friendly, pleasing to the eye, and informative:
- By only spending a few minutes on the site, visitors learn:
- The mission and purpose of the chapter.
- Who the chapter leaders are and how to reach them.
- What activities are coming up.
- Who has been helped this year through activities led by chapter members.
- What congregations are in the chapter.
- The layout of the site also is a winner as each page:
- Is short (not much scrolling needed).
- Contains much white space.
- Includes a beautiful picture of the local landscape within the chapter.
"I don't have any formal Web site training," says Janelle, "but the Lutherans Online Web site templates make developing a site and upkeeping it easy."
Janelle plans to include more pictures and detailed descriptions of chapter activities so that "members and others can see how the Grant County WI Chapter is making a difference in our churches and communities."
Without any formal Web site training, why would Janelle ask to be the Internet Advisor? "I volunteered to develop the site because I noticed our chapter didn't have a Web site manager and I decided it was a great way for me to volunteer," she says. "I grew up seeing first hand the difference that Thrivent Financial and local volunteers make by helping others."
As for the Web Site of the Month honor, Janelle quickly passes credit to the chapter members and volunteers. "Without their faithful efforts, a Web site would not be needed," she says.
